"Mysterious Magic," best known as the second opening theme for the anime Fairy Tail, is rousing J-rock built for the moment a battle begins — and this rendition channels that adrenaline directly. The production is driving and melodic: chugging guitars, a propulsive rhythm section, and a soaring chorus that captures anime opening conventions at their most effective, balancing aggression with an irresistible singalong hook. The vocal delivery is impassioned and theatrical, pushing toward an emotional peak that mirrors the show's themes of friendship, perseverance, and magical adventure. The lyric essence centers on the "mysterious magic" of bonds and belief — the conviction that camaraderie and willpower can overcome any darkness, a message woven into Fairy Tail's DNA. The cultural context is the rich tradition of the anime tie-in song, where a track lives a double life: as a standalone J-rock number and as the 90-second adrenaline burst that primes viewers each episode, becoming inseparable from the emotions of the series. The listening scenario is energizing and nostalgic — fans of the show feel an instant rush of recognition, while newcomers get a crisp shot of melodic rock momentum. It's music engineered to make you feel like the hero stepping onto the battlefield, all forward drive and defiant hope, the kind of opening theme that fans replay long after the credits roll.
